Dixie Chicks Get ‘Checked Out’
Impossible To Rent & Difficult To Buy - ‘Shut Up & Sing’ At Last
by John Young

WACO, Texas —

snip//


One problem is that I no longer knew how to contact my friend Jerry. He’s the one-time convenience-store employee who supplied for me a copy of Martin Scorcese’s “Last Temptation of Christ,” in a brown envelope, back in 1988.

That controversial film was stopped at every port in our landlocked city - not shown in theaters; couldn’t rent it; couldn’t buy it; the cable company blocked it on Showtime.

Three summers ago when Waco theaters weren’t showing “Fahrenheit 9/11,” I tried to hook Michael Moore up with Jerry so that we in Waco could see what all the fuss was about. Moore liked my idea but took my middle man out of the equation. Sorry, Jerry. He sent the film to peace groups who cued it up in the Crawford High School football stadium parking lot before some 3,000 people.

Now here we are in 2007 with a similar problem, and no Jerry to facilitate. So deeply did I feel about the right of people in our community to decide for themselves on matters like “Shut Up and Sing” that I said to myself, “OK. I’m going into video rental.”

I would buy the video for $16.99, and then would rent it to you and yours to recoup my investment.

I’m so happy to tell you I didn’t have to do that. I didn’t because I made one more call. I should have thought about it first:

The public library.

The Waco-McLennan County Library has a copy of “Shut Up and Sing.” It will loan you that copy for free if you have a library card. This means I won’t have to rent it to you. That’s a relief. I already had enough on my hands leading various tribes out of the wilderness.

I told reference librarian Sean Sutcliffe about my problems renting the video. We speculated that this might be a problem elsewhere in America’s heartland. Then he did a computer search for the title in other libraries in the country. Publicly supported beacons of free inquiry popped up on his screen by the hundreds.

What a country.
